Mission

The Noroton Heights Fire Department, Incorporated provides fire and other emergency response services to its district within the Town of Darien, Connecticut, as well as providing mutual aid coverage to the other fire departments in town and to surrounding communities, both upon request and upon established agreements. The department is totally staffed by volunteers, 24 hours per day. The response service includes extinguishment of fire of any sort (structural, vehicle, open land, etc.), emergency extraction of victims and structure stabilization, of vehicle accidents and other entrapments, search and rescue of lost persons, initial hazard material response and other emergency situation responses of a nature requiring immediate action due to person or property being at risk. The department serves approximately 40% of the town of Darien, responding to approximately 300 alarms. Property and building which house the department is owned by the department.
